LAMBERT RELIEVED WITH BENTEKE PROGNOSIS

 
Aston Villa manager Paul Lambert has expressed his relief at finding out that Christian Benteke’s injury was not as bad as first feared.
Benteke, who netted 19 goals in 34 Premier League appearances last season, had to be helped off the pitch in Villa’s 1-0 win over Norwich City on Saturday with a hip problem.
Subsequent scans then revealed the striker will be out of action for up to six weeks due to a hip flexor issue.
This news has been greeted by Lambert though, as he felt the Belgium international may have been sidelined for longer.
"The medical people give you the best and worst-case scenario," he said.
"You are never quite sure until you hear from the professor.
"Thankfully it is not too serious. Maybe four, five, six weeks or so."
Benteke could miss up to six Premier League fixtures as Villa look to improve on a start to the season that has seen them collect six points from five games.
